The selected Proposer shall design, construct, install, interconnect, operate, maintain, and monitor the system at the facilities described in Exhibit A and sell the electricity generated from the system to BCSD in accordance with the Solar Energy Procurement Agreement structure. All output generated at a facility shall be used at that facility and the selected Proposer shall not sell the output beyond the capacity limit of any individual facility. Unless cost effective, batteries should not be proposed at this time. The scope of service shall include all tasks required to design, fabricate, deliver, install, operate, monitor, and maintain the system. The scope shall also include, but not be limited to, securing all permits and approvals from governing agencies and paying all labor costs, taxes, service fees, permit fees, and equipment costs necessary to produce a fully operational system as described in detail below 1) Design, engineering, and permitting Opportunities for details related to tie-in locations, building voltage and specific phase details for each building will be made available at the prescheduled site visits. The selected Proposer shall design/engineer the system to maximize energy savings in consideration of the facilities' load profiles, the size, and conditions of the proposed site, proposed future site improvements, and other relevant factors. The selected Proposer shall supply to BCSD the design documents and drawings, stamped by an appropriately licensed Georgia professional engineer, that includes the following minimum information: a. Timeline/Project schedule b. System description c. Equipment details and description including information on modules (brand name, model, size, and technology), inverters (brand, type, and efficiency), and monitoring and data acquisition systems d. Layout of installation e. Layout of equipment f. Specifications for equipment procurement and installation g.
